如何实现数据中心可视化系统的历史数据查询?
在当今数字化时代,数据中心已成为企业运营的“大脑”,其重要性不言而喻。为了更好地管理和维护数据中心,实现数据中心可视化系统的历史数据查询功能变得尤为重要。本文将深入探讨如何实现数据中心可视化系统的历史数据查询,帮助您更好地了解这一技术。
一、数据中心可视化系统概述
数据中心可视化系统是指通过图形化界面展示数据中心运行状态、设备性能、能耗等信息,以便于管理人员实时监控和调整。该系统具有以下特点:
- 实时性:实时显示数据中心各项指标,便于管理人员快速发现问题。
- 全面性:涵盖数据中心运行、设备、能耗等多个方面,为管理者提供全面的数据支持。
- 易用性:图形化界面操作简单,易于学习和使用。
二、实现数据中心可视化系统的历史数据查询
- 数据采集
数据中心可视化系统的历史数据查询功能需要依赖数据采集模块。该模块负责从各个设备、传感器等采集实时数据,并将其存储在数据库中。以下是数据采集的几个关键步骤:
- 设备接入:确保数据中心所有设备接入系统,包括服务器、存储设备、网络设备等。
- 传感器部署:在关键设备上部署传感器,实时监测设备运行状态。
- 数据传输:通过有线或无线方式将采集到的数据传输至服务器。
- 数据存储
采集到的数据需要存储在数据库中,以便后续查询和分析。以下是数据存储的几个关键步骤:
- 选择合适的数据库:根据数据量和查询需求选择合适的数据库,如MySQL、Oracle等。
- 数据建模:根据数据特点设计合理的数据库表结构,确保数据存储高效、安全。
- 数据备份:定期对数据库进行备份,防止数据丢失。
- 数据查询
数据查询是数据中心可视化系统的核心功能之一。以下是实现数据查询的几个关键步骤:
- 开发查询接口:根据用户需求开发查询接口,支持多种查询方式,如按时间、设备、指标等。
- 优化查询算法:针对大数据量,优化查询算法,提高查询效率。
- 可视化展示:将查询结果以图表、曲线等形式展示,便于用户直观了解数据。
- 案例分析
以某大型数据中心为例,该数据中心采用可视化系统实现历史数据查询,具体做法如下:
- 数据采集:通过部署传感器、采集卡等设备,实时采集服务器、存储设备、网络设备等数据。
- 数据存储:采用MySQL数据库存储采集到的数据,并定期进行备份。
- 数据查询:开发查询接口,支持按时间、设备、指标等多种查询方式,并将查询结果以图表形式展示。
通过实施可视化系统,该数据中心实现了以下成果:
- 实时监控:管理人员可以实时了解数据中心运行状态,及时发现并解决问题。
- 数据分析:通过对历史数据的分析,优化数据中心资源配置,降低能耗。
- 决策支持:为管理者提供数据支持,辅助决策。
三、总结
实现数据中心可视化系统的历史数据查询功能,有助于提高数据中心的管理效率,降低运营成本。通过数据采集、数据存储、数据查询等环节,可以构建一个高效、稳定的数据中心可视化系统。在实际应用中,还需根据企业需求不断优化和改进,以实现更好的效果。
猜你喜欢:DeepFlow